> Index: lib/Target/R600/SIISelLowering.cpp
> ===================================================================
> --- lib/Target/R600/SIISelLowering.cpp
> +++ lib/Target/R600/SIISelLowering.cpp
> @@ -179,6 +179,9 @@
>      MVT::v8i32, MVT::v8f32, MVT::v16i32, MVT::v16f32
>    };
>  
> +  setOperationAction(ISD::SELECT_CC, MVT::i1, Expand);
> +  setOperationAction(ISD::SELECT, MVT::i1, Promote);
> +
>    for (MVT VT : VecTypes) {
>      for (unsigned Op = 0; Op < ISD::BUILTIN_OP_END; ++Op) {
>        switch(Op) {

> Index: test/CodeGen/R600/select-i1.ll
> ===================================================================
> --- /dev/null
> +++ test/CodeGen/R600/select-i1.ll
> @@ -0,0 +1,14 @@
> +; RUN: llc -march=r600 -mcpu=SI -verify-machineinstrs < %s | FileCheck -check-prefix=SI -check-prefix=FUNC %s
> +
> +; FIXME: This should go in existing select.ll test, except the current testcase there is broken on SI
> +
> +; FUNC-LABEL: @select_i1
> +; SI: V_CNDMASK_B32
> +; SI-NOT: V_CNDMASK_B32
> +define void @select_i1(i1 addrspace(1)* %out, i32 %cond, i1 %a, i1 %b) nounwind {
> +  %cmp = icmp ugt i32 %cond, 5
> +  %sel = select i1 %cmp, i1 %a, i1 %b
> +  store i1 %sel, i1 addrspace(1)* %out, align 4
> +  ret void
> +}
> +
